Background
The wireless charger is a charger which is connected to terminal equipment needing charging without a traditional charging power line, the latest wireless charging technology is adopted, a magnetic field generated between coils is used, electric energy is transmitted miraculously, the inductive coupling technology can become a bridge for connecting a charging base station and the equipment, and the wireless charging technology has the advantages of convenience and universality.
The mobile communication terminal display props based on the wireless charging technology in the market are all fixed on a desktop for people to visit, the simulation degree and the simulation degree of the mobile communication terminal display props are poor, the direction of the angle of the mobile communication terminal display props cannot be changed, a visitor cannot carefully watch the mobile communication terminal, the terminal is directly placed at the upper end of a wireless charging base, and therefore when the visitor touches the terminal, the terminal is easily caused to fall off from the base.

Specifically, the fixing component 3 includes a groove 301, the groove 301 is formed on the upper surface of the housing 1, a fixture block 302 is fixedly connected to the lower surface of the fixing table 2, the fixture block 302 is clamped in the clamping groove, a first limiting groove 303 is formed in the fixing table 2, a first limiting rod 304 is inserted in the first limiting groove 303, a first limiting block 306 is fixedly connected to the surface of the first limiting rod 304, a first spring 305 is sleeved on the surface of the first limiting rod 304, a handle 307 is fixedly connected to one end of the first limiting rod 304, a first taper block 308 is fixedly connected to the other end of the first limiting rod 304, a second limiting groove 309 is formed in the fixture block 302, the first limiting groove 303 is communicated with the second limiting groove 309, a second limiting rod 310 is inserted in the second limiting groove 309, and a second limiting block 312 is fixedly connected to the surface of the second limiting rod 310, the surface of the second limiting rod 310 is sleeved with a second spring 311, the inner wall of the groove 301 is provided with a positioning groove 314, one end of the second limiting rod 310 is fixedly connected with a second taper block 313, the first taper block 308 is matched with the second taper block 313, the other end of the second limiting rod 310 is clamped in the positioning groove 314, by arranging the fixing component 3, when people need to fix the fixing table 2 with the placing table 5, people only need to pull the handle 307 and drive the first limiting rod 304 to move upwards so as to separate the first taper block 308 from the second taper block 313, under the cooperation of the second spring 311, the second limiting rod 310 is pushed to move towards the second limiting groove 309, meanwhile, the fixing table 2 with the placing table 5 is clamped in the groove 301, then the handle 307 is loosened, and under the action of the first spring 305, the first limiting rod 304 is pushed to move downwards, the first taper block 308 and the second taper block 313 are ensured to interact again, and the second limiting rod 310 is pushed into the positioning groove 314, so that the fixing of the fixing table 2 loaded with the placing table 5 is completed, and the working pressure of people is relieved.
